Compare University Park to La Porte
This post compares University Park, Texas to La Porte, Texas across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.
Dimension | University Park (city) | La Porte (city) |
---|---|---|
Population | 24,692 | 35,216 |
Income (median) | $159,497 | $51,769 |
Home Value (median) | $1,193,800 | $131,500 |
White | 91% | 82% |
Black | 1% | 4% |
Asian | 5% | 1% |
With Kids | 53% | 34% |
Age (median) | 32 | 37 |
Rentals | 19% | 26% |
